Ticket: Config drift on Murmeline log sampling

The Murmeline ingest service is chatty by design, and we sample its logs at 1-in-50 in prod. Last week's hotfix on the Castellan cluster reverted sampling to 1-in-5, and log volume tripled, pushing the retention budget into the red. Drift detector flagged it this morning. On-call: please reconcile the live values against the committed baseline and restore sampling. The values currently running on Castellan are shown below.

config for tagep-yajef:
ulawyn:
  log_level: error
  metrics_host: metrics.ulawyn.lumiclabs.internal
  pin: 0564
  pool_size: 32

Quick capacity note for review: the Mossvale replica-lag alarm has been flapping since we added the nightly export job. Rather than silencing it, I'm widening the threshold and adding a sustained-window check so one slow query doesn't page anyone. Replica count stays the same for now. Proposed thresholds are listed below.

limits module of bawef-bajep:
CAPS = {
    "novvan": 877,
    "quenvan": 327,
}

Memo — sample run to Ardwick Analytical

Hi — quick note so the week goes smoothly. The Norrel project samples head out to Ardwick Analytical on Wednesday, and the office needs to have the shipping paperwork printed and signed by Tuesday close. The courier from Fleetline arrives around 08:30, so please have reception buzz them straight back to the prep room. Nothing fancy here, just the usual two coolers plus the manifest folder. One important bit: make sure the driver gets the hand-over instruction below:

handover note for yagef-bagep: the drudor pelius courier leaves the kasdor zorvan norir ledger at gate 8016 under passcode 755406

Subject: Fabrikit cut-over complete

Team — the migration from SeedSmith to Fabrikit for test-data generation finished tonight. All factories now resolve through the Fabrikit registry; legacy seeds are read-only until Friday. If CI flakes on fixture builds, restart the factory daemon before escalating. For on-call reference, the daemon now runs with the configuration shown below.

config for kawif-hahig:
zorix:
  log_level: error
  metrics_host: metrics.zorix.lumiclabs.internal
  pool_size: 16